ALL ABOUT FC RED STAR BELGRADE
8/3/2006 3:19:00 PM
Fudbalski klub Crvena zvezda – FC Red Star Belgrade

The club was founded in 1945 and their uniform is comprised of a red and white striped jersey, red shorts and red socks.

Trophies: 24 State Championships, 21 National Cups, 1 European Cup, 1 Intercontinental Cup.

Red Star's city rival is FK Partizan. The Serbian league starts on Saturday and their first game is at home against Voždovac Belgrade.

President: Dragan Stojkovic.

Coach: Dusan Bajevic.

Red Star eliminated Cork City to qualify for the third preliminary round. Score: Cork City-Stella Rossa 0-1 (1 goal Behan), Stella Rossa-Cork City 0-3 (Milovanovic, Zigic 2 goals). Lineup (4-4-2): Randjelovic; Pantic, Bisevac, Joksimovic, Basta; Perovic, Jankovic, Kovacevic, Milovanovic; Georgiev, Zigic.

Red Star has played against an Italian team 19 times: with 3 victories for the Biancorossi, 6 ties and 10 Italian victories.

Red Star has played Milan once: in 1988 when Arrigo Sacchi won his first European Cup, they met in the final-sixteen, first leg in Milan (1-1), then second leg in Belgrade where the game was suspended due to fog, an amazing shot by Van Basten was cancelled in the rescheduled game and after 120’ with the result still 1-1 they went into a penalty shootout, in which Rossoneri hero Giovanni Galli scored the winning goal.
